Ember data 如何将其表示为余烬数据模型?

Ember data 如何将其表示为余烬数据模型?,ember-data,Ember Data,我使用的是ember数据1.0.0-beta.7+canary.b45e23ba RESTful服务返回的JSON负载为: { "postalAddresses": [ { "street": "12345 Test Drive", "city": "Testville", "subnational": "WA", "postalCode": "98027", "country": "United States",

我使用的是ember数据1.0.0-beta.7+canary.b45e23ba

RESTful服务返回的JSON负载为:

{
  "postalAddresses": [
    {
      "street": "12345 Test Drive",
      "city": "Testville",
      "subnational": "WA",
      "postalCode": "98027",
      "country": "United States",
      "id": 1
    },
    {
      "street": "12345 Work Drive",
      "city": "Testville",
      "subnational": "WA",
      "postalCode": "98027",
      "country": "United States",
      "id": 2
    } 
  ],
}
我的DS.Model应该是什么样子

var postaladdresses = DS.Model.extend({
    street:  DS.attr('string', {defaultValue: ''}),
    city:  DS.attr('string', {defaultValue: ''}),
    subnational: DS.attr('string', {defaultValue: ''}),
    postalCode:  DS.attr('string', {defaultValue: ''}),
    country:  DS.attr('string', {defaultValue: ''}),
我还没有找到专门针对这种情况的文档。我在目标上吗?这是预定的设计吗?注意:我无法更改发送给我的有效负载

谢谢你


Jeff

关键是我的“命名根”或“json根”是一个数组。忽略这个问题。我对余烬数据如何工作的理解是不正确的。